Z-1872-2017 Class II Ongoing

Recalled by CP Medical Inc — Norcross, GA

FDA device recall Z-1872-2017 was initiated by CP Medical Inc on February 2, 2017 and is designated Class II. Reason for recall: The tensile strength minimum as directed by USP <881> was not met over the length of the product's shelf life. The recall status is ongoing. Affected quantity: 504 boxes/12 sutures - 6,048 individual sutures.
